少儿编程语言怎样选择?南京少儿编程下面的内容就给各位家长来详细的科普一下,希望能帮助到大家对少儿编程的了解。
scratch所使用的是一个可视化编程软件,在软件中儿童能用类似积木堆叠的方法来实现代码的快速编程。极客晨星对于Scratch编程课程体系的考量,拥有自主研发+scratch,逻辑性强;独创模块/代码随时互换,。自然过渡,有效衔接,从入门模块编程到实战代码编程。通过游戏化互动式教学的形式,让学生与老师零距离交流,从根源上减少孩子对编程的陌生感。创新的主题游戏,易于掌握的学习方法让孩子在轻松愉悦的学习环境中快速掌握编程的力量。让孩子将编程当做感知世界的工具。循序渐进地引领学生一层一层突破学习难关,再潜移默化中形成编程思维,实现*编写代码的能力。
而真正的编程进阶选择,则是从C,C++和python开始的。先说python,现在越来越重视素质教育,python作为最好理解的通用语言受到了社会的喜爱。学习python,极有可能对将来高考产生影响。并且在大数据时代,python的作用非常广泛,无论是用于数据清洗统计,还是人工智能数据标记,都少不了python的身影。
六阶课程设计,阶段巩固复习
学习基本程序结构。能够按步有序地完成作品。在有趣而简单的作品创作中,入门编程,培养分步意识,启蒙编程思维,激发编程兴趣。
进一步学习广播、变量等编程知识。能在流程图的引导下进行编程实践 和创作。在作品实现及问题分析中,培养自主思考及问题解决能力。
学习掌握基本程序结构的进阶使用。能够使用思维导图对作品进行分析和拆解。能够逐渐编写较复杂的代码。完成具有创意的作品设计。
学习声音侦测、物理模块等进阶知识。通过了解语音识别、人脸识别 等人工智能领域知识,拓宽编程视野。创作出实用、科技感的作品。
理解较复杂的程序逻辑嵌套。学习列表相关知识。能够对多样化作品进行数据处理。完成逻辑结构较难、机制复杂的作品创作。
完成大作品的设计与创作。能编写结构完整,功能复杂的代码。进一步提升抽象归纳、算法设计等能力。应用编程解决实际问题。